Summary of Position
Under the supervision of the Head Women’s Hockey Coach, The Director of Women’s Hockey Operations will be directly responsible for all things pertaining to equipment, both at home and on the road. The position will serve as the primary contact and manager of the team’s travel. He or she will work directly with the Business Service Center to manage the team’s equipment purchase invoices, winter break training expenses and other budgetary items. The position will participate in marketing efforts for the team, video management and compliance

Institution Information
The University of New Hampshire is an R1 Carnegie classification research institution providing comprehensive, high-quality undergraduate and graduate programs of distinction. UNH is located in Durham on a 188-acre campus, 60 miles north of Boston and 8 miles from the Atlantic coast and is convenient to New Hampshire’s lakes and mountains. There is a student enrollment of 13,000 students, with a full-time faculty of over 600, offering 90 undergraduate and more than 70 graduate programs.
